Do you work nightshift and struggle to maintain good health?
 

Over an extended working life, shift workers are subject to proven harmful effects of disrupted bio-rhythms. It is important for all shift working nurses and midwives to be supported in self-protective strategies with training across a working life, starting from when they enter the profession.
